TSB Chapter 6: Never Bring A Knife To A Machine Gun Fight

Written By: Thomas
POV: Ginny

Ginny addresses the readers, reminding us that she recently became "a Prayer Warrrrrrrrior" (Eight Rs- I hope I got that correct). She refuses to provide a recap, and insists that we read the previous chapters again if we feel the need, but decides to explain why- she wants something after her death to prove that she didn't waste her life, she believes atheists stupid for believing that life was an accident, and she thinks that the Bible effectively answers all her questions.

Ebony then gets a bit closer to the subject at hand by saying that Draco has given her a test, but then goes off on a tangent by saying that she loves him, not in a romantic way (since he's married to Ebony), but Like Brother and Sister, and more than her actual brother, "Rob." As might be expected, Thomas gets off a "Fuck you, Noah" in the process, and it's not hard to see why. Since Ginny now hates Ron and Percy killed Tyson, I have to wonder if there are any healthy sibling relationships in this series.

Ginny's mission involves chatting up some Satanists in the London underground, one of whom happens to be Harry himself. Harry then goes off on a Cluster F-Bomb, even though his words merely indicate mild surprise at seeing Ginny again after her death at Michael's hands. The narration reminds us that only Satanists swear, even though the author just did himself.

Ginny lies and says that the traitor killed Michael, although her inner feeling seem to imply that it's meant to be true. Harry notes that he's pleased to hear that, and that the traitor is important, but he's disappointed to note that Dumbledore doesn't trust him enough to tell him his identity. Finally, we're actually seeing something remotely in character for Harry, and I actually wonder if the author intentionally referenced Harry's frustration over being Locked Out of the Loop in Order of the Phoenix.

In spite of the fact that Harry apparently doesn't know the most important information Ginny continues and hopes to get information out of Harry. As Harry pours a glass of wine, Hermione gets out a knife, but Harry gets out a machine gun. He smugly informs her that he saw through her plan, and gave her "truth syrup", before demanding to know where Draco and Michael are.
